H2O Markets Limited Background
H2O Markets Limited: A Comprehensive Financial Services Profile
Registered with Companies House under number 07029238 and previously holding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) Firm Reference Number 511520, H2O Markets Limited operated within the regulated financial services sector. The company’s transition from a fully regulated entity to a status of ‘Regulatory approval no longer required’ on 11/01/2019 signals significant regulatory intervention.
